[the structure of a log message] The usual way to compose a log message of this project is to - Give an observation on how the current system works in the present tense (so no need to say "Currently X is Y", or "Previously X was Y" to describe the state before your change; just "X is Y" is enough), and discuss what you perceive as a problem in it. - Propose a solution (optional---often, problem description trivially leads to an obvious solution in reader's minds). - Give commands to somebody editing the codebase to "make it so". in this order. The proposed log message lacks the motivation and only talks about what the patch does. We add a test-only code in a file, intermixed with production code. Let's explain why it is the best arrangement. > Signed-off-by: Lidong Yan <502024330056@smail.nju.edu.cn> > --- > pack-bitmap.c | 73 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++---- > pack-bitmap.h | 1 + > t/helper/test-bitmap.c | 8 +++++ > t/t5310-pack-bitmaps.sh | 27 +++++++++++++++ > 4 files changed, 103 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-) After the second round of the series, no review comments seem to have been sent to the list.
